The two biggest hurdles in practicing hospitality, strangely enough, are:  Who to invite and actually getting around to doing the inviting!!

Solving the Who problem!

Last year we decided to invite 12 families….one each month…..over for dinner.  Well, we flopped royally!  I think we had maybe 3 families over the entire year!  So this year we are starting fresh and I have a plan….I love plans!  I decided to be slightly more systematic in our invites.  Using our church directory as a guide we are inviting two families from the beginning of the alphabet and then switching to the end and inviting two families from the end!  Because you know if you always start at the beginning that poor Zimmerman family is never invited over EVER!  And by the way, we don’t actually have a family in our church named  Zimmerman…..it was the only Z last name I could think of.

Doing the inviting!

I have no idea why this is such a struggle for me….it seems easy enough to pick up the  phone, dial the number and set a date on the calendar.  But it’s an extra…..one of those little things that seem to get lost in the cracks of my day.  About three weeks ago I realized that lots of “extras” were getting lost.  So each Sunday night I sit down and make a list of my “extras” for the coming week.  I love lists.  I love marking stuff off lists.  I feel accomplished when I’ve completed the entire list…..ok 75% of the list…..during the week.  And so inviting was added to my list and I did it!  I made the phone call, got a date on the calendar and hospitality was about to happen at the House of Smooches!
